As a new stone's throw wireless communication way, Bluetooth is widely used for its low price, low power and high speed, by which can set up personal area networks between fixed and mobile equipment and share resource with others in the touch.Bluetooth operate between 2.4~2.48GHZ of free ISM frequencies. it can efficiently anti-jamming and spread spectrum by FHSS(Frequency Hopping Spread Spectrum). So it has merit such high speed, low Bit Error Rate and strong anti-jamming.Protocol and principle of Bluetooth is studied include RF, Base-band, protocol of internet applications and the encryption of info in Bluetooth system. Then analyze the principle of frequency modulation and choice, the kernel and hopping frequency. Especially, the co-frequency and near-frequency disturb in the communication path was studied. Meanwhile, the principle and the ability of anti-jamming of AFH was analyzed and studied.Most of all, the principle and flow of encryption in Bluetooth, EO arithmetic and the principle encryption of LFSRS(Linear Feedback Shift Registers) was studied. For it has linearity, the means of "known plaintext attack" to it is effective. In order to deal with this problem, a new encryption base on DES is brought forward. DES belong to group encryption, which is fit for the principle of nowadays internet. Meanwhile, because confusion principle, diffusion principle and avalanche effect exist in DES, key effect each other. Once one of it is changed, some bit of the other key and cryptograph also will be changed. So it can't be divided-and-conqued.For its merit, the vehicle detect implement based on Bluetooth used in SCOOT was brought forward which can conquer this defect of traditional detect technology such as low of nicety ,high of build and service ,short lifespan and easily disturbed by weather. In the end, after the principle and structure of ETS studied, a new ETS based on Bluetooth was printed under the condition of problem and status in the build of nowadays ITS and ETS. Meanwhile, the software and hardware of it was given. Compare to traditional ETS, the new means can conquer some defect such as traffic's delay and huddle, the misplay or embezzlement of the operator, high social charge and lower efficiency. So it has true and scientific significance.
